65daysofstatic Release Of The Destruction Of Small Ideas Deluxe Edition

20 September 2012 | 4:33 pm | Alex Wilson

The legendary post-rock crew drop their second album, with bonus material, in anticipation of their Australian tour in 2012/2013

More 65daysofstatic More 65daysofstatic

Not only are the UK electro-post-rock legends 65daysofstatic gearing up for their first tour down under in 2012/2013, but they have just announced the Australian release of their 2007 album The Destruction of Small Ideas, through indie label Bird's Robe Records.

The Australian version of The Destruction of Small Ideas will be released as a deluxe package, featuring an additional disc of bonus material. It follows on from the earlier deluxe edition of their latest record, We Were Exploding Anyway (bundled with the Heavy Sky EP), with the bands first two albums to come through Bird's Robe further down the track. The band's current Australian releases can be streamed and purchased on Bandcamp.

On record, 65daysofstatic are known for an exhilarating sound where emotionally-charged guitar rock collides head-on with aggressive live electronics borrowed from IDM, trance and drum 'n bass. Their ability to translate this sound into a energetic and euphoric live show has earned them a reputation as one of instrumental rock's premier touring acts. They have shared the stage with Metallica, The Cure and Battles and appear at world-class festivals such as Summersonic and Sonisphere.

Their 2012/2013 Australian tour will be their first ever Australian tour and will see them put in appearances at Peats Ridge Festival with additional headline shows in Perth, Sydney, Melbourne and Brisbane.
